  • Title

    A plastic lens with anti-reflective structures using a nanoporous alumina template with lens curvature

  • Abstract
    This work presents a novel fabrication method for a millimeter-sized plastic lens with anti-reflective structures (ARS) for diverse illumination and imaging applications. The ARS lens was molded from a curved surface with nanoporous aluminum oxide by two-step anodization.
